Handover note — Crumbwheel order cutoffs.

Welcome aboard. The bakery cutoff rule in Crumbwheel closes same-day orders at 14:00 local to each storefront, not UTC — this has bitten us twice. Holiday overrides live in the calendar service and take precedence silently, so always check there first when a cutoff looks wrong. To unlock the calendar service's admin console after a restart, enter the recovery passphrase below.

vault phrase of bagap-bahaf = silion-pelox-sorox-casdor-quenwyn-fraax-eliox-praael-kelion-quenvan-kasox-rusael-norius-belvan

## Runbook: Wiki role-based access (Fernhollow)

Quick note for review: Fernhollow wiki roles map to three tiers — reader, curator, steward. Stewards can edit ACLs, curators can't. The sync job that mirrors roles into the Gatewren service runs hourly and needs its own credential. For the audit, the current sync key is included below.

gateway credential: kto23_LX9A4ys6i4nzHtpOLNLodKK

[ ] Security sign-off: the Tailspool CLI release. Quick rundown for the reviewer — we tightened scope so the tool can only tail streams the caller's role already grants, no wildcard follows anymore. Redaction filters now run client-side before anything hits the terminal, and the session transcript feature is off by default. Please double-check the auth handshake hasn't regressed; last cycle we shipped a bypass by accident. Sign off only against the exact artifact, verified by the build token below.

pipeline stamp: htk4_ae36